HC Deb 22 February 1961 vol 635 cc52-3W
50. Mr. Gooch

asked the Secretary of State for War what is the amount of War Department land at Weybourne, Norfolk, needed for a defence project; and what he proposes to do with the land not so needed, and the 36 houses which have not been lived in for two years.

Mr. Profumo

Eight acres. I propose to sell the surplus land and the houses to the former owners if they wish, subject to certain restrictions necessary for the defence project over part of the land.
